BioWare - Image 1So it would appear that some third-party developers are getting what Stardock meant - the fate of PC gaming is on the hands of the developers. BioWare, a reputable PC developer of the past, has also expanded to the console market like many others, but they aren't about to abandon the gaming platform. Speaking to MTV, CEOs Ray Muzyka and Greg Zeschuk said that the role-play experts might keep developing PC exclusives in the long run. Logo of Apple, Inc. - Image 1The wait is finally over as Apple recently announced the release of the latest Mac OS X software update. Mac OS X 10.5.4 Leopard includes some general operating system improvements which enhance the stability, compatibility, and security of your Mac.
